Output 79574c24d5f39e18b0d3806d18e872ad4151fd2a621b47bd28fdd5f8ac3a79aa:16

value
2589829
script pubkey
OP_0 OP_PUSHBYTES_20 51fe3f8db69b6e8d4eb207864d2cabd5b743d5d8
address
bc1q28lrlrdkndhg6n4jq7ry6t9t6km584wc4qv4h0
transaction
79574c24d5f39e18b0d3806d18e872ad4151fd2a621b47bd28fdd5f8ac3a79aa
spent
true